The Philippines are on the other side of the world, when will my VA work?

Your VA works your hours, your time zone and when you want them to. Our VAs work the schedule you need, whether that is 8 am – 5 pm Monday-Friday, or weekend nights. We only ask that your VA has two consecutive days off to maintain a healthy work-life balance.

How do you ensure quality VAs?
We have a rigorous vetting process where we will narrow down a pool of applicants from 1500 to 10. The candidates will need to go through multiple interviews, multiple assessments, pass a background check, and score an 80% or higher in our “boot camp”; before ever getting placed in front of you. We do our best to ensure the candidates we present during interviews are experienced, dedicated, and trustworthy.
How does time off work?
Our VAs mirror a “typical” U.S. holiday calendar except that our VAs also receive Juneteenth off and three days at Christmas (Christmas Eve, Christmas Day and the day after Christmas). Christmas is celebrated even larger than in the U.S. and we aim to provide a Holiday schedule that benefits both our Clients and VAs. Let us know if you ever need your VA to work on a Holiday and we will always work with you.
